DELPHI盒子
!实时搜索: 盒子论坛 | 注册用户 | 修改信息 | 退出
检举帖 | 全文检索 | 关闭广告 | 捐赠
技术论坛
 用户名
 密  码
自动登陆(30天有效)
忘了密码
≡技术区≡
DELPHI技术
lazarus/fpc/Free Pascal
移动应用开发
Web应用开发
数据库专区
报表专区
网络通讯
开源项目
论坛精华贴
≡发布区≡
发布代码
发布控件
文档资料
经典工具
≡事务区≡
网站意见
盒子之家
招聘应聘
信息交换
论坛信息
最新加入: liy187
今日帖子: 0
在线用户: 4
导航: 论坛 -> 移动应用开发 斑竹:flyers,iamdream  
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/5 11:45:42
标题:
@小帆 安卓下怎样让 Bass库 多线程播放音乐? 浏览:1189
加入我的收藏
楼主: http://bbs.2ccc.com/topic.asp?topicid=532091 此贴在添加 BASS_DEVICE_16BITS flag 后,前台播放没有杂音了,但后台播放依然有杂音。但 delphi 自带例程 FMMusicPlayer 以及 TMediaPlayer 后台播放都没有杂音,看了下源码,貌似是开了多线程来播放。但是我不知道怎样把 bass库 放到线程中来播放音乐,所以来请教下你。
----------------------------------------------
http://mcool.appinn.me/
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/5 12:26:26
1楼: delphi 的 DEMO 都是调用 系统 API,DLEPHI 开发者懒得去管什么多线程。
----------------------------------------------
(C)(P)Flying Wang
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/5 13:21:15
2楼: @Flying Wang 搞了几个月,播放器两大功能,扫描音乐刚刚解决,我不再管什么SD卡了(TFlyFilesUtils都不用了),直接从根目录 / 开始,让用户去选择目录;播放音乐至今还不完善(后台播放有杂音),你说我泄气不泄气..

用 TMediaPlayer 可完美解决,也可以播放 APE 等无损音乐,但我无从知道它到底支持多少种音频格式,TMediaCodecManager.GetFileTypes 返回的是 MP3 等寥寥无几两三种格式!
----------------------------------------------
http://mcool.appinn.me/
作者:
男 zoujun3281 (无奈) ▲▲▲▲▲ -
普通会员
2017/5/5 15:08:21
3楼: 早日用java不然以后多的是泄气的时候
----------------------------------------------
delphi你妹
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/5 15:23:33
4楼: 楼上,java 不支持 iOS。
----------------------------------------------
(C)(P)Flying Wang
作者:
男 sail2000 (小帆工作室) ★☆☆☆☆ -
盒子活跃会员
2017/5/7 17:53:43
5楼: 多线程播放?官方自带的 netradio 就是啊,至于用服务,暂时没空学习呢,最近业余时间都花在研究网易云的api了,就是网上的 java 代码转成的,其实啊 java 也很容易懂。搞明白他的数据类型和运算符先就好写了,至于面向对象什么的,delphi本身就很好理解。
此帖子包含附件:
PNG 图像
大小:261.1K
----------------------------------------------
delphi 是兴趣,和工作无关,即使它倒闭。又不靠它 delphi 吃饭,怕甚?
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/11 18:18:27
6楼: 嗯,小帆前辈又走在了前面。线程貌似无效果,只有在服务方面想办法了
----------------------------------------------
http://mcool.appinn.me/
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/11 18:23:57
7楼: 昨天 群友 老新手 提到了
PowerManager ,你的进程调用他,可以锁定 CPU ,甚至 屏幕。
这样 服务就可以一直运行了。
----------------------------------------------
(C)(P)Flying Wang
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/12 20:44:05
8楼: @Flying Wang 真是奇技yin巧啊,连服务都可以省了,不过这样一来,屏幕会一直亮着,有没有办法获取系统休眠时间,并且手工关闭屏幕?
----------------------------------------------
http://mcool.appinn.me/
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/15 8:41:01
9楼: 楼上胡说,屏幕是不是亮,是参数。爱亮不亮。
----------------------------------------------
(C)(P)Flying Wang
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/15 14:22:22
10楼: 楼主,你是不是忘了你这个破帖子了?
----------------------------------------------
(C)(P)Flying Wang
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/15 16:09:32
11楼: 是要忘了,因为设置 WakeLock 仍然无济于事,虽然延长了后台播放时间,但还会卡顿
----------------------------------------------
http://mcool.appinn.me/
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/15 16:14:31
12楼: 你不是说不需要服务了吗?
----------------------------------------------
(C)(P)Flying Wang
作者:
男 diystar (diystar) ★☆☆☆☆ -
普通会员
2017/5/15 21:57:15
13楼: 一般来说是不用服务了,可以免杀了,但音乐播放器偏偏还要考虑是否流畅不卡..
----------------------------------------------
http://mcool.appinn.me/
作者:
男 wang_80919 (Flying Wang) ★☆☆☆☆ -
普通会员
2017/5/17 8:39:02
14楼: 你自己说的,服务里卡,不是服务,不卡。
----------------------------------------------
(C)(P)Flying Wang
信息
登陆以后才能回复
Copyright © 2CCC.Com 盒子论坛 v3.0.1 版权所有 页面执行255.8594毫秒 RSS